Transaction 59c733c41f42f99ca397b00116ccc471335851e778505ae2f90b8a574e622a94

1 Input
2 Outputs
  • 59c733c41f42f99ca397b00116ccc471335851e778505ae2f90b8a574e622a94:0
  • value  323640000
    address  1NsCUxqWDYnWVavV9fY8CeZ1fKE58gWhZp
  • 59c733c41f42f99ca397b00116ccc471335851e778505ae2f90b8a574e622a94:1
  • value  1099276752
    address  3JoSWSrtxgiT81iLKikoN9ntGNJbCjLiML